The 2013 Mercedes-Benz S-Class is a considerable reworking of the automaker’s flagship sedan. The brand’s standard-bearer introduces several new safety systems. Thus Mercedes is to reestablish itself as a safety leader, yet focalizing on the efficiency. So what does the new model get? I guess one of the most notable safety features is the “braking bag” which is located between the front wheels. As a matter of fact, when the crash happens, the bag inflates while pushing the metal plate onto the ground in order to slow down the car. A new set of seat-mounted side airbags is also included. The airbag-equipped seatbelts are offered as optional.



The upcoming sedan will be longer and feature the new aluminum-intensive unibody. The engine choices are: a twin-turbocharged V-8 and a new V-12. The Benz fans will be certainly glad to know that right after the S-class rolls out, the super stretched “Pullman” version, 267-inch-long will come out to replace the Maybach 57/62. The Pullman will be a rival to such models as Rolls-Royce Ghost and the Continental Flying Spur. If compared to the spy photos of the model seen over a year ago, the 2013 S-class is surely to take a new design direction. For example, the second side contour line which extends from the rear door handle to the rear quarter panel has gone away.



Expect the official presentation of the new S-Class at some major international auto show this year. The sedan will hit the road in 2014 priced at $90,000. The vehicle will enter into competition with Jaguar XJ, Audi A8, Porsche Panamera, and BMW 7-series.
